I would like to know if credit cards like Eurocard and Diners are usfiul in Paris. I would use them to purchase tickets (for example ticket to Louvre, Eiffel tower,...), Carte Orange, and some markets and not expensive restaurants.
I thing carying cash is not as practical as credit cards. And I don't know how much money I'll spend.
BTW: My credit cards were issued in EU (in Slovenia).

Thank you for any advice.

I cannot help you with Eurocard, but I did not see that Dinners was accepted that much in France. There is a four star hotel in St Paul de Vence that only accepts Dinners, but I think that is because there are no limits on the card. I would recommend a VISA or Master Charge. I have never had a problem with either.

you can even pay with CC at McDonald's- although often there is a minimum amount. defitely no problem at museums, carte orange, hotels and restos. not a markets though. Does diner's still exist? MasterCard/Eurocard and Visa are the ones to go for.
